I love this for so many reasons!
It has the AU single-rail Sea Dart, the soviet-style SSM layout is so well thought out yet doesn't detract from the Western looks, looks very capable too with a nice mix of weapons and sensors. Looks vaguely Type 22-ish (even a bit like the never-built Type 25) and Perry-ish but has its own style.

One minor personal nitpick, I would be tempted to move the Type 970 jammer (the big box on the foremast) lower down as I think its a weighty bit of kit and you've lots of weight up top.
The separate fire-control for Sea Dart and Sea Wolf is unavoidable unfortunately, but you've done a good job of fitting everything in with good arcs.

Novice wrote:
I don't see any anti-ship weapon on board. The large cruise missiles are for land attack (or so I believe) while the other missiles are anti-air or anti-submarine. Maybe you can find a place for some medium/small calibre gun (say a 3").
I left off a gun of some kind to prevent it being too big/overloaded plus with its original design role of open ocean ASW, surface-surface action was considered to be a very minor role. You're correct about the cruise missiles being primarily land attack but I'm toying with the idea of an anti-ship variant that would be useful if a little overkill for most targets and I figured Sea Dart could be used in an anti-ship role if necessary. The last 3 ships of the class will be replacing the Sea Dart launcher with a 4.5in gun probably in the mid/late 1990s and fitting Sea Eagle AShMs at a similar point is a possibility also.
